General Information
Title: Factum est silentium
Composer: Philippe de Monte
Lyricist:
Number of voices: 6vv Voicing: SATTBB
Genre: Sacred, Motet for the feast of Michael the Archangel
Language: Latin
Instruments: A cappella
First published: 1598 in Sacrae symphoniae (Caspar Hassler, Nuremberg), no. 36
